noosfero | pg-search: facets implementation (!1171)

Rodrigo Souto gitlab at mg.gitlab.com
Thu Apr 13 20:20:14 BRT 2017


New Merge Request !1171

https://gitlab.com/noosfero/noosfero/merge_requests/1171

Project:Branches: diguliu/noosfero:facets to noosfero/noosfero:master
Author:    Rodrigo Souto
Assignee:  

## Facet Implementation

This commit includes a facets implementation for the pg_search plugin.
It uses Postgresql Full-Text Search with its basic indexation through
the pg_search gem.

The facet is coded in a extensible way, with current support for filtering
by a specific attribute or based on a relation.

## Core

   * Added facets and periods options to full_text_search method (no
     signature change).
   * TimeScopes improvement with more generic scopes.
   * Normalization of search order scopes by including table names.
   * Search page style improvemetns
   * Add friendly mimetype support


---
Reply to this email directly or view it on GitLab: https://gitlab.com/noosfero/noosfero/merge_requests/1171
You're receiving this email because of your account on gitlab.com.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://listas.softwarelivre.org/pipermail/noosfero-dev/attachments/20170413/3e91e71c/attachment.html>


More information about the Noosfero-dev mailing list